Lunatic

Lunatic adjective - Showing or marked by a lack of good sense or judgment.
Usage example: such lunatic clowning during church services is completely inappropriate

Pinheaded

Pinheaded adjective - Not having or showing an ability to absorb ideas readily.
Usage example: pinheaded leadership that got us into this mess
